Turkish police have arrested 92 people over their suspected links to the Daesh/ISIS terrorist group during anti-terror operations in 26 provinces, the Turkish interior minister said on Friday, APA reports.
The operations was conducted simultaneously in 26 provinces by the Turkish police’s anti-terror teams, Ali Yerlikaya said on X.
“We will not let terrorist organizations and their collaborators breathe,” Yerlikaya vowed.
“I want our beloved nation to know that: Our struggle will continue with determination and resolve until the last terrorist is neutralized,” he added.
